It's officially a scam... I just got this response from the seller:

"If you leave feedback to us,
We can ship item to you after we receive it.
But you don't leave feedback,we ship item within 21 days because paypal hold money 21 days.
Please leave feedback to us,Thank you"

Will be starting a Paypal dispute shortly.
 
I just opened a paypal dispute with this message:

"I am opening this now so that I can protect myself from the possibility of not receiving the product. Your response has thrown up many red flags as I know for a fact that Paypal doesn't wait 21 days to clear payments when they are sent directly through paypal. Also asking for me to give you feedback before receiving the item is against ebay policies.

If I receive a the *NEW* PSP as described in your auction, this dispute will go away. If I do not receive the PSP in a within 30 days I will escalate this to the highest authority given. I will also make sure that ebay knows about your shady practices.

If my assumptions are completely wrong and you are a stand up seller, I will revoke everything I have said and will give you the highest praise possible on ebay. Something tells me this is not going to happen though.

Best Regards,
-Jon"
